Note: These county rules apply to unincorporated areas of St. Joseph County. If you live within an incorporated city, that city's own rules apply: see the city list below.
Frequency, Duration & Permits
A garage or yard sale on a residential lot in unincorporated St. Joseph County is capped at three sales per calendar year, each running no more than three consecutive days, and sales can only run from sunrise to sunset. No improvement location permit is required, but leftover items have to come inside or off the property once the sale ends.
St. Joseph County Garage Sale Frequency Limit
Light RestrictionsSt. Joseph County, Ind., Zoning Ordinance § 154.071(H)
(H)Garage and yard sales. Notwithstanding any regulations above to the contrary, a garage sale may be conducted on a premises which includes a dwelling unit subject to the following regulations.(1)A garage sale/yard sale may be conducted three times each calendar year per lot and shall not exceed three consecutive days in duration.(2)A garage sale/yard sale shall only be conducted during the ho...
